I'd look at something like the PJ Trailers 5" Channel Buggy Trailer. It has drive over fenders and has a bunch of available options.
http://http://www.pjtrailers.com/detail.cfm?ID=B5

Otherwise you'd be looking at one of the deckover options from PJ/Big Tex/others. Those are also really nice but the downside is they are a big trailer (width wise) and I think even more importantly the CG of your load starts getting high.

Probably depends on what other uses you have in mind and what your tow vehicle is.

I don't remember how wide my JK measures, but it is on 60s with 40" Irok's. It squeeeezes through the fender on my Kaufman trailer. I'm not a fan of deck over trailers for the higher CG and wind resistance but they really aren't too bad depending what you are pulling with. A couple of things to think about if you haven't already: 1) you need a 10k gvw trailer. Your JK is probably over 6k lbs, the trailer itself will be at least 1500 lbs. and you'll always throw extra crap in too. This will put you way over weight with a 7k gvw. 2) check to make sure the tires are rated for the load! Lots of trailers come with tires rated less than the trailer gvw. 3) don't forget the spare along with a lug wrench to fit and a jack. I love the little ramp thingy as a jack. Works awesome. 4) you might think about a gooseneck trailer depending what you use it for overall. goosenecks are awesome but of course more money and there are some obvious drawbacks.
